Very daunting to work with Big B, Farhan: Bejoy

Director Bejoy Nambiar says it was daunting for him to direct megastar Amitabh Bachchan and actor-filmmaker Farhan Akhtar in his upcoming film 'Wazir'.
'Wazir' stars Amitabh Bachchan, Aditi Rao Hydari, Farhan Akhtar and Varun Gulu.
"It's very daunting and intimidating when you work with such a star cast. At no point they made me feel like I am a newcomer or less experienced. I have to forget I am directing Big B and Farhan. I have to do justice to what Vidhu Vinod Chopra and Abhijat have written," Bejoy told reporters at the teaser launch of 'Wazir' here.
"I feel fortunate that I am getting to work with such brilliant people. It's been a great learning course for me. Vidhu Vinod Chopra writing, Raju Hirani editing and Amitabh Bachchan and Farhan Akhtar acting. I really hope the film comes up to everyone's expectations," he said.
Chopra is full of praise for Bejoy. "He has nicely directed the film," he said.
"We take four-five years to write scripts and make film. We never run behind a film or a project. We don't make a film until and unless we are satisfied... I am very proud of this young man (Bejoy)," he said.
Bachchan plays the character of a paralysed chess grand master while Farhan Akhtar dons the tough look of an ATS officer.
On reports that actors Neil Nitin Mukesh and John Abrahan too are part of this film, Bejoy said, "They both play pivotal roles in the film. It's special appearance.
